But I feel everybody should see and fully appreciate this opening paragraph:

In the wild, a worm blob looks like any other mud ball lolling around the bottom of a pond. But if you poke an unassuming worm blob, it will respond in a way a mud ball never would, wriggling out into a noodly shape that a Pastafarian might mistake for something divine.

I don't know what exactly is going on with the Science Times editing, but it surely is a marvel.

Behold, the Worm Blob and Its Computerized Twin
